St.
George’s University (SGU) recognizes academically gifted students with
limited resources deserve the ability to reach their potential that’s
why 60 full-tuition scholarships will be awarded to Commonwealth
citizens under the St. George’s University, Grenada, Commonwealth
Jubilee Scholarship Program, commemorating the 60 years of the Queens
reign as the Head of the Commonwealth of Nations.

Scholarship value/inclusions:
The
scholarship funds tuition only. Students must have a financial plan in
place to fund living and travel expenses through their own personal
resources or alternative funding sources.
Eligibility:
A
prospective scholarship candidate must be a resident citizen of a
Commonwealth country, have been accepted to St. George’s University, and
submit an essay detailing how this award will ultimately benefit the
development of his/her country.
Application instructions:
The scholarship application and essay must be submitted by the following deadlines: 1 June for the August class and November 1 for the January class.
